Fixed Income Rotational Program Analyst
Federal Home Loan Bank of Des Moines is committed to fostering an inclusive culture that supports a diverse workforce. The Fixed Income Rotational Program Analyst role is designed for recent graduates to gain exposure to key concepts in bank funding, hedging strategies, and investment portfolio management, while developing core skills applicable across fixed income departments.
